Bear Valley Mountain Resort in California experienced a historic snowstorm that deposited more than 100 inches in four days, followed by a three-day closure for safety. Upon reopening, Saturday delivered bluebird powder conditions with minimal lift lines. The snow had compacted slightly from its initial depth, allowing for fast riding without getting bogged down. Riders accessed the backside terrain including Spyglass, BlueJay Way, and West World before heading to Grizzly Bowl, California's only true 180-degree bowl. When open, Grizzly Bowl transforms Bear Valley into a compelling ski destination with endless exploration possibilities including Snow Valley, West Ridge chutes, and natural cliff features.
